Eureka Releases and Updates

New features are incorporated into Eureka on a continuous integration / continuous deployment basis. As enhancements are incorporated into Eureka, current Eureka users are notified and details are included in the Release Notes, below.

Eureka v4.0 - January 12, 2023

  • Updated from Centos 7 to Ubuntu 22.04

  • Swapped out NoMachine for Apache Guacamole

July 12, 2021

Updates available in new Eureka App-VM instances or upon Instance Owner request:

  • Enabled Software Collections repository

  • Updated monitoring and logging agents

  • Automated CentOS patching

  • Enabled internet access CLI; Added help screen to GUI

  • Created sets of TMPDIR for R clients to resolve common user problem when building R packages

  • Introduced script to improve installation of Anaconda packages

  • Provided an easy installation file for SAS. Please contact Compass to obtain sudo permissions required to complete installation

App VM Version 3.0: July 20, 2020

Features:

  • Limited internet access! Time limited access to pre-defined URLs will be enabled on the Eureka App VM. Details on what URLs are included can be found here. Note that the mirrored Bioconductor Repository will be going away with this release. If you are on a Eureka v2 instance, you will need to be upgraded a v3 instance.

App VM Version 2.0: December 12, 2019

Features:

  • Redesigned Eureka connection to be accessible entirely as a web-based login solution.

  • Nightly backups of Eureka App VM images in case disaster recovery is needed.

App VM Version 1.6: September 2, 2019

Features:

  • Access to local mirror of the Anaconda repository within Eureka; updated daily. Release is no longer available because of unstable updates to Anaconda.

  • Access to local mirror of the PiPy repository within Eureka; updated daily. Release is no longer available because of a change with the storage of the repository on Cloud Storage.

App VM Version 1.5: August 18, 2019

Feature:

  • Updated version of R from 3.5 to 3.6.

App VM Version 1.4: July 15, 2019

Features:

  • Access to local mirror of the Bioconductor repository within Eureka; updated daily.

  • Local mirror of CRAN repository within Eureka updated daily.

App VM Version 1.2: April 1, 2019

Feature:

  • Automatically shut down idle VM after 20mins. This helps ensure users are not charged when the VMs are not being used.

App VM Version 1.1: December 20, 2018

Features:

  • Access to local mirror of the CRAN repository within Eureka

  • Preinstall SAS (version 9.4) on Eureka Linux VMs (at User request)

App VM Version 1.0: Initial Release. October 1, 2018

Features:

  • Approval for PHI-containing datasets from all Compass partner institutions

  • CentOS 7-based VMs, with both console and GUI (Gnome Desktop) access

  • CPUs and RAM from any combination available on Google Cloud Platform

  • Initial suite of open source data science and software development packages preinstalled

  • Users can start and shut down VMs on demand

v1 Known Bugs:

  • Bug: New Eureka VMs must be logged into, then rebooted, before VNC connections can be made.

HPC Version 1.0: November 5, 2020

Features:

  • Approval for PHI-containing datasets from all Compass partner institutions

  • CentOS 7-based VM with python3 and latest version of R (3.6.3).

  • Limited internet access available.

  • Support for migrating from Rosalind HPC to Eureka HPC.
